Abstract

The invention discloses a charging station system for new-energy automobiles. The charging station system comprises direct-current bus, a plurality of charging piles, a first man-machine operation module, a second man-machine operation module, a data collecting module, a video collecting module, a central processor, a predicting and analyzing module and an expert evaluation module, wherein the input end of the direct-current bus is connected with a power supply system, and the charging piles are hung to the direct-current bus; at least two carbon-based capacitor battery packs which work in a synchronous and same-phase manner, a coupling magnetic integration inductor, at least one power supply voltage isolation rectifying device and at least one power switch conversion component are arranged in each charging pile. The charging station system has the advantages that charging pile conditions can be monitored and analyzed in real time, the balance of output currents among parallel power supplies is guaranteed, current sharing is achieved, the service life of the charging piles is prolonged, power system stability is achieved, the harmonic currents of the charging piles are reduced, the carbon-based capacitor battery packs are coordinated with wind-driven and solar power generating system, and the market requirements of energy conservation and emission reduction are satisfied.

Description

technical field [0001] The invention relates to the field of new energy, in particular to a charging station system for new energy vehicles. Background technique [0002] New energy vehicles refer to vehicles that use unconventional vehicle fuels as power sources, integrate advanced technologies in vehicle power control and drive, and form vehicles with advanced technical principles, new technologies, and new structures. At present, the use of electric vehicles is gradually being promoted, but a major factor restricting the development of electric vehicles is the equipment of charging stations. With the rapid development of electric vehicles, the charging station has become the focus of the development of the automobile industry and the energy industry.
